In a Q&A with Computerworld, Richard Stallman, the founder of the Free Software Foundation has lots to say about Microsoft’s position – or lack thereof – over the GPLv3.

He sees Microsoft’s deal with Novell backfiring against Microsoft. Oh, and while he’s at it, he asks that that world stop confusing GNU with Linux.
